An interview from 2020 reveals the business was founded by Felipe Correa, who transitioned from a broader concierge service to focus specifically on tours in 2006. His stated focus is on "Nature, history, people, art," aiming to showcase the "Real Florida" beyond superficial attractions.

Service and Logistics

Beyond the guide's performance, logistical competence is another highlighted positive. One review for a day trip from Weston to Key West noted the convenience of the drop-off and pick-up location on Carolina Street, calling it a "great starting point." This detail, while small, speaks to thoughtful travel planning and an understanding of the customer's experience on the ground. The use of a third-party provider, Academy Buses, for transportation was also mentioned positively, suggesting that Tours to You! partners with reputable companies to execute its vacation packages. This B2B model, which includes working with timeshare resorts, indicates a level of trust within the local tourism industry.

The company’s website and background information confirm a focus on key South Florida destinations, including the Everglades, Miami, and the Florida Keys. This specialization allows for deep expertise rather than a superficial overview of many locations. The business caters to both group and private excursions, offering the potential for customized travel itineraries tailored to specific interests. This flexibility is a considerable advantage for families or groups who want a more intimate experience than larger, more rigid tour companies can provide.
